Commercial roof assessment services involve a thorough inspection of a building’s roofing system to evaluate its current condition and identify potential issues. These assessments typically include visual inspections of the roof surface, drainage systems, flashing, and other critical components. Some providers may also incorporate the use of specialized tools or equipment to detect hidden problems such as leaks, structural weaknesses, or areas of deterioration. The goal is to gather detailed information that helps property owners understand the health of their roof and determine necessary repairs or maintenance to extend its lifespan.
These assessments are instrumental in addressing common roofing problems such as leaks, ponding water, membrane deterioration, and storm damage. By identifying these issues early, property owners can prevent more extensive damage that could lead to costly repairs or even roof replacement. Regular assessments also help detect signs of aging or material failure, ensuring that maintenance can be scheduled proactively. Additionally, assessments can uncover underlying problems that are not immediately visible, providing a comprehensive understanding of the roof’s overall integrity.
Commercial properties that frequently utilize roof assessment services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, manufacturing facilities, and institutional structures such as schools and hospitals. These properties often have large, complex roofing systems that require regular evaluations to maintain safety and functionality. Facilities with flat or low-slope roofs, which are more prone to water pooling and membrane issues, particularly benefit from routine assessments. Assessment Costs - The cost for a commercial roof assessment typically ranges from $500 to $2,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ate roofs may incur higher fees.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Inspection Fees - Inspection fees for commercial roofs generally fall between $300 and $1,500. Factors influencing the cost include roof height, accessibility, and the extent of the inspection required. Contact local pros for precise pricing tailored to the property.
Report and Analysis Expenses - Detailed roof condition reports and analysis services us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These reports often include recommendations for repairs or replacement. Prices vary based on the report’s depth and the assessment scope.
Additional Evaluation Costs - Additional evaluations such as thermal imaging or material testing can add $500 to $2,500 to the overall assessment expenses. These specialized services help identify hidden issues not visible during standard inspections. Local contractors can provide specific quotes for these services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a commercial roof assessment? A commercial roof assessment involves evaluating the condition of a building's roof to identify potential issues, damages, or areas needing repair or maintenance.
How often should a commercial roof be assessed? It is recommended to have a commercial roof assessed regularly, typically annually or after severe weather events, to ensure its integrity and longevity.
What are common signs indicating the need for a roof assessment? Signs include leaks, visible damage, sagging, membrane deterioration, or increased energy costs related to poor insulation.
What does a commercial roof assessment typically include? The assessment generally includes a visual inspection, evaluation of roofing materials, and identification of potential problem areas.
